Yellow peas (Y) are dominant to green peas (y). Cross two heterozygous yellow pea plants. - What is the genotype ratio? What is the phenotype ratio?

Answer:

Step-by-step explanation:

Genotype ratio --> 1 YY : 2 Yy : 1 yy

Phenotype ratio ---> 3: 1 (3 yellow, 1 green).
